Important Attributes for Premium Scrubs
High-performance scrubs furnish a portfolio of vital aspects that fulfill the distinct needs of healthcare professionals. First and foremost, sweat-resistant material guarantees that wearers stay dry and comfortable during long shifts. Additionally, these scrubs often feature antimicrobial properties, assisting in the reduction of the risk of infection and odor. Flexibility is another crucial feature; many designs apply four-way stretch materials that allow for unrestricted movement, crucial in fast-paced environments.
Functional pockets are also important, delivering easy access to tools and personal items while keeping a streamlined appearance. Moreover, durability is key, as high-performance scrubs are designed to endure frequent washing and wear without losing their shape or color. Finally, air-permeable materials boost airflow, keeping healthcare workers cool under pressure. Together, these features combine to create scrubs that support the demanding lifestyle of healthcare professionals, allowing them to focus on patient care without distraction.

Guidelines for Caring for Your Scrubs
Maintaining scrubs properly guarantees they preserve their quality and longevity. To accomplish this, washing scrubs in cool water is advised, as it helps preserve colors and material strength. Using a gentle soap without bleach will safeguard the material from deterioration. It is important to eliminate fabric softeners, which can diminish the scrubs' moisture-wicking properties.
Upon cleaning, scrubs should be air-dried or tumble-dried using low heat to avoid shrinkage. Ironing is typically unnecessary, but if preferred, a low-temperature setting is advised to avoid damage. Frequently inspecting for stains and addressing them promptly can avoid lasting discoloration.
Placing scrubs in a fresh, dry space distant from direct sunlight will also extend their lifespan. By following these care steps, individuals can confirm their high-performance scrubs remain effective and looking professional throughout their use.

Frequently Raised Questions
Do Advanced Scrubs Function for Every Healthcare Sector?
High-performance scrubs are ideal for different healthcare fields, including nursing, surgery, and emergency services. Their sturdy fabrics and purposeful designs address the demands of different roles, boosting comfort and efficiency in diverse environments.
How pricey are advanced-technology scrubs relative regular scrubs?
High-performance scrubs typically cost more than regular scrubs due to superior fabrics and improved functionality. However, their durability and comfort may justify the higher price for many medical workers looking for excellence in their work attire.
Are High-Performance Scrubs Able to be Customized or Labeled?
High-performance scrubs can often be personalized or tailored, enabling healthcare professionals to showcase logos, names, or distinctive patterns. This customization strengthens team identity while preserving the scrubs' practical advantages and superior performance.
What Span Can a Average High-Performance Scrub Remain?
Premium-grade scrubs typically endure for 2 to 3 years when properly cared for. Factors such as fabric quality, frequency of use, and washing methods significantly affect their durability, impacting overall longevity in rigorous professional settings.
